Output 674ad176677361871d519a9f68a326d889a4707b4dd71148734e966ba1a64f39:0

value
469432
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3765c6bccdf1ec64cc87cf0010ba357400261 OP_EQUAL
address
3BMEXkFEW1UZnV6nVX5LRUie8J9FFcYRQR
transaction
674ad176677361871d519a9f68a326d889a4707b4dd71148734e966ba1a64f39
confirmations
391662
spent
true